Ten Years and 1,000 innings in the books

10th Annual 100 Innings of Baseball

The world's longest game played its 1,000th inning, following the completion of the 10th annual 100 Innings of Baseball.

Team Third Base defeated Team First Base by a final score of 79-69 in a shorter-than-usual 28 hours. Exactly 21 Iron Men played the entire game, setting a new event record.

Fundraising for ALS this year via "The Angel Fund" has surpassed $560,000. Thank you to all of the players, umpires, sponsors, and contributors who have pitched in to make this game a success over the last decade!

Chris Deane and Tom Trull earned co-MVP honors for their dish work, each catching more innings than knee-savers ever could have expected when they created their product. Well done, fellas.
